Basic Information of Protein
UniProt ID TSSK2_HUMAN
UniProt AC Q96PF2
Protein Name Testis-specific serine/threonine-protein kinase 2
Gene Name TSSK2
Organism Homo sapiens (Human).
Sequence Length 358
Subcellular Localization Cytoplasm. Cytoplasm, cytoskeleton, microtubule organizing center, centrosome, centriole . Present in the cytoplasm of elongating spermatids. In spermatozoa, localizes in the equatorial segment, neck, the midpiece and in a specific sperm head compart
Protein Description Testis-specific serine/threonine-protein kinase required during spermatid development. Phosphorylates TSKS at 'Ser-288' and SPAG16. Involved in the late stages of spermatogenesis, during the reconstruction of the cytoplasm. During spermatogenesis, required for the transformation of a ring-shaped structure around the base of the flagellum originating from the chromatoid body..
